Black sand is primarily formed through the weathering and erosion of volcanic rocks. When volcanic eruptions occur, they release a variety of minerals, including iron, magnesium, and titanium. These minerals are then transported by wind, water, and gravity to nearby bodies of water, where they settle and accumulate over time. The constant abrasion and friction between the volcanic minerals and other particles lead to the formation of smooth, dark grains that we recognize as black sand.
